Former Senior Unilever Executives launches food brand FairPlum; raises $2 million

Rupesh Agarwal, Mayank Tandon & Mitesh Thakkar have announced the launch of their entrepreneurial innings with FairPlum, a food company which will deliver authentic food to consumers without compromising on health and hygiene.

Rupesh Agrawal and Mitesh Thakkar are ex Unilever, have worked in leadership roles across functions like Finance, procurement, manufacturing, product development and personal care. Mayank Tandon, is an F&B specialist and entrepreneur who has led, built and scaled hospitality brands at Reliance Retail, Sanjeev Kapoor Restaurants, Future Group Cloud Kitchens. He has managed a diverse portfolio of building restaurants, large commissaries, cloud kitchens and food retail, in India and in International markets.

Fairplum wants to make foods/brands accessible by bringing authentic foods from across the world at great quality, and value. Our vision is to run a network of hundreds of cloud kitchens/ physical experience centers on which we will ride our most authentic and iconic foods and their brands from all over the world,” shared Agrawal, Founder & CEO, FairPlum.

The group has also raised $2 million in a seed round led by Mumbai-based early stage focused VC Unicorn India Ventures. Reputed angels Vivek Sirohi, VP-R&D, Unilever, Amith Agarwal, Co-Founder & CEO at Agri-Bazaar, Dinshaw Family Office, Anisha Subandh have also participated in the round.

Founded in 2020, FairPlum aims to create products & brands which the consumers love, a food company that delivers authentic flavors and food nostalgia to customer doorsteps in less than an hour.

“FairPlum leverages technology to enhance efficiency and preserve the taste of the food which will be delivered in under an hour. The food industry is undergoing a significant revolution especially with its creativity, innovation and cutting edge technologies. We saw a strong pipeline of user base and business traction addressing food nostalgia which is why we decided to invest in them further,” added Anil Joshi, Managing Partner, Unicorn India Ventures.

FairPlum has launched Kebabi Karvaan which is a sub brand of Food Karvaan that makes Iconic Foods Accessible and Unmarried Kitchen, a brand aimed at bachelors. The Company has also launched Street Food Karvaan, Rollz Karvaan and Crafted.
